I got two specimens of Cirrhilabrus marjorie this afternoon (around 14:00) in April 22, 2007. The first import to Japan.
Top; female, about 70mm and
Bottom; male, 80mm; both from the central Fiji Islands.
The male is still in colors of fear at the bottom. The female is freely swimming around the tank and accepting foods well. I will show more photos of the male tomorrow.
This species is endemic to Fiji and dwells at the depths between 20-50 meters and was described by Allen, Randall & Carlson, 2003. Males will reach 8cm, and females sometimes are larger than males in a harlem.
